Brief Summary

Review the sponsor-provided synopsis that highlights what the study is about and why it is being conducted.

To evaluate the clinical value of splenectomy as a treatment for relapsed haemophagocytic lymphohistiocytosis (HLH) in patient with unknown etiology.

Eligibility Criteria

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.

Inclusion Criteria

1. Patients were older than 14 years of age
2. Diagnosed as Hemophagocytic Lymphohistiocytosis (HLH) according to HLH-2004.
3. patients were excluded with infection, rheumatic and immunologic diseases, malignant tumors (especially lymphoma), and primary HLH.
4. Informed consent

Exclusion Criteria

1. Pregnancy or lactating Women
2. Active bleeding of the internal organs
3. Uncontrollable infection
4. Contraindication of splenectomy
5. Participate in other clinical research at the same time
